Before You Begin

Before you start installing your new basketball hoop, it's important to make sure you have all the necessary tools and materials. Here's what you'll need:

  • Shovel or post hole digger
  • Level
  • Tape measure
  • Mixing bucket
  • Concrete (80 lbs)
  • Water
  • Socket wrench set
  • Adjustable wrench
  • Phillips head screwdriver
  • Rubber mallet

Once you have all the necessary tools and materials, you can start the installation process.

Step 1: Choose a Location

The first step in the installation process is to choose a location for your new basketball hoop. The Lifetime 54 In Ground Basketball System is designed to be installed in the ground, so you'll need to choose a spot that is level and free from any obstacles like trees or power lines.

Once you've found a suitable location, use the tape measure to mark out the area where you'll be digging. The hole should be 18 inches in diameter and at least 48 inches deep.

Step 2: Dig the Hole

Using the shovel or post hole digger, start digging the hole where you marked it. Make sure the hole is deep enough to accommodate the pole and provide stability for the basketball hoop.

Once you've dug the hole, use the level to make sure the bottom of the hole is level. This will ensure that the basketball hoop is also level once it's installed.

Step 3: Install the Pole

Now it's time to install the pole for the basketball hoop. Insert the pole into the hole and use the level to make sure it's straight. Hold the pole in place while you mix the concrete.

In the mixing bucket, combine the concrete and water according to the instructions on the bag. Once the concrete is mixed, pour it into the hole around the pole. Use the rubber mallet to tap the pole to help settle the concrete.

Make sure the pole remains straight and level while the concrete sets. It's best to let the concrete set for at least 72 hours before continuing with the installation process.

Step 4: Assemble the Basketball System

Once the concrete has set, it's time to assemble the basketball system. Start by attaching the backboard to the pole using the provided hardware. Make sure the backboard is level and secure before moving on to the next step.

Next, attach the rim to the backboard using the provided hardware. Make sure the rim is level and secure.

Finally, attach the net to the rim. The net should be attached securely so it doesn't come loose during play.

Step 5: Adjust the Height

The Lifetime 54 In Ground Basketball System allows you to adjust the height of the rim from 7.5 feet to 10 feet. To adjust the height, use the socket wrench set and adjustable wrench to loosen the bolts on the back of the pole. Once the bolts are loosened, slide the rim up or down to the desired height and tighten the bolts again.
